Have you ever stopped to ponder whether you’re truly seeing reality from various perspectives, or are you unknowingly confined to a single viewpoint, disregarding the existence of others?

From a tender age, we’re susceptible to unconscious indoctrination. Others carve out predetermined pathways of thought, leading us to unwittingly adopt opinions, thoughts, and emotions that aren’t genuinely ours.

But here’s the thing: indoctrination doesn’t teach us how to think, but rather what to think. It confines us within the suffocating boundaries of conventionality, stifling our ability to explore beyond these confines.

It’s alarmingly simple to slip into these prescribed patterns of thought, absorbing the opinions and emotions of others as our own. Unfortunately, society often neglects to equip us with the critical thinking skills necessary to navigate this maze of influence. As a result, we find ourselves ensnared within the clutches of our own blind spots.

These insidious patterns of behavior infiltrate societies worldwide, targeting belief systems ranging from religion to education, from self-identity to money. They start by destabilizing our very sense of self, instilling self-doubt, and guilt. Before we know it, we’re shackled by repetitive behaviors, trapped in a cycle of conformity.

It’s time to reclaim our autonomy. It’s time to challenge the status quo, to confront the narratives that have long dictated our thoughts and actions. It’s time to break free from the mental chains of unconscious indoctrination.

How do we embark on this journey of liberation? It begins with a simple act: questioning. We must question the sources of information that inundate us daily. We must question the meanings behind these narratives, discerning whether they serve any useful purpose. And ultimately, we must cultivate a conscious awareness—a panoramic perspective that transcends the narrow confines of indoctrination.

But let’s not stop there. Let’s be bold. Let’s ask the uncomfortable questions, challenge the entrenched beliefs, and unlearn the falsehoods we once accepted as truth. Let’s embrace skepticism as a virtue, for it is through skepticism that we pave the path to enlightenment.

Consider this: a child raised in an environment steeped in political ideology. From an early age, they absorb these beliefs, never questioning their validity. This scenario epitomizes the insidious nature of unconscious indoctrination—a cycle perpetuated by our collective reluctance to challenge the status quo.

But fear not, for the journey towards enlightenment begins with a single step. As J. Mike Fields aptly stated, “Fearful men control, intelligent men analyze, but wise men listen with intent to understand.” Let us heed these words and embark on a quest for understanding—a quest that leads us towards genuine enlightenment.

Developing a habit of critical reflection can serve as a powerful antidote to unconscious indoctrination. Take time each day to reflect on your beliefs, values, and attitudes, asking yourself probing questions such as ‘Why do I hold this belief?’ or ‘What evidence supports this perspective?’ This process of self-interrogation can help you identify and challenge any ingrained biases or assumptions, allowing you to cultivate a more discerning and independent mindset. By actively engaging in critical reflection, you can fortify yourself against the influence of unconscious indoctrination and reclaim agency over your own thought processes.

Consider the myriad ways in which unconscious indoctrination may have influenced your own life. Reflect on the beliefs, values, and behaviors that you’ve adopted over the years, and ask yourself: How much of this is truly mine, and how much has been shaped by external influences? By examining your own experiences through this lens, you can gain valuable insight into the pervasive nature of indoctrination and begin to challenge its hold on your psyche. Remember, awareness is the first step towards liberation. Embrace the opportunity to question, explore, and reclaim your autonomy from the grips of unconscious indoctrination.

Let us confront the indoctrination that shackles our minds and stifles our potential. Let us embrace critical thinking, self-awareness, and the pursuit of truth. For it is through these endeavors that we shatter the chains of indoctrination and forge a path towards genuine understanding and enlightenment.
